david database lab

 
 

常用链接

  • 我的随笔
  • 我的评论
  • 我的参与
  • 最新评论

留言簿(3)

  • 给我留言
  • 查看公开留言
  • 查看私人留言

随笔分类

  • 书画 (rss)
  • 围棋 (rss)
  • 地理 (rss)
  • 天文 (rss)
  • 摄影 (rss)
  • 文学 (rss)
  • 旅游 (rss)
  • 电影 (rss)
  • 诗集(3) (rss)
  • 象棋 (rss)
  • 运动 (rss)
  • 音乐 (rss)

随笔档案

  • 2008年9月 (1)
  • 2008年7月 (3)

文章分类

  • AJAX (rss)
  • ARITHEMETIC (rss)
  • C++ (rss)
  • CONFIGURATION (rss)
  • CSS(2) (rss)
  • DB2 (rss)
  • EJB (rss)
  • HQL (rss)
  • HTML(4) (rss)
  • JAVA(9) (rss)
  • JAVASCRIPT(27) (rss)
  • JSP(2) (rss)
  • LINUX(7) (rss)
  • MANUAL (rss)
  • MYSQL (rss)
  • ORACLE(88) (rss)
  • PL/SQL(3) (rss)
  • PL/SQL DEVELOPER (rss)
  • REGEX(1) (rss)
  • RSS(2) (rss)
  • SQL (rss)
  • SQL PLUS (rss)
  • SQL SERVER (rss)
  • SSH (rss)
  • STRUTS(6) (rss)
  • TOAD (rss)
  • XML(1) (rss)
  • 单元测试 (rss)
  • 数据库基础(7) (rss)
  • 数据建模 (rss)
  • 环境部署(5) (rss)
  • 项目设计(1) (rss)

文章档案

  • 2009年11月 (47)
  • 2009年8月 (2)
  • 2009年7月 (2)
  • 2009年6月 (11)
  • 2009年5月 (14)
  • 2009年4月 (2)
  • 2009年2月 (4)
  • 2009年1月 (2)
  • 2008年12月 (5)
  • 2008年11月 (6)
  • 2008年10月 (13)
  • 2008年9月 (3)
  • 2008年8月 (6)
  • 2008年7月 (16)
  • 2008年6月 (31)
  • 2008年5月 (4)

相册

  • goole相册
  • RELAX

收藏夹

  • oracle-DataGuard (rss)
  • oracle-RMAN (rss)
  • oracle体系 (rss)
  • oracle备份恢复 (rss)
  • oracle闪回 (rss)

JavaScript Web

  • gegereka-linux
  • linux 资源文件
  • java2s (rss)
  • java2s
  • onlyaa
  • ORACLE官方论坛
  • rpm.pbone.net
  • rpm资源
  • struts-guide
  • w3school
  • 鸟哥

搜索

  •  

最新评论

  • 1. re: hand in hand
  • I cannot thank you enough for the blog . Really thank you! Really Cool.
  • --zakbut
  • 2. re: oracle之isqlplus登录问题
  • 启动isqlplus
    isqlplus star
  • --广州大道
  • 3. re: 日期日间控件4
  • 显示时间,用户原来选择的时间
  • --LVWallet
  • 4. re: linux -- cpio命令
  • gunzip 10201_database_linux_x86_64.cpio.gz
  • --Goyard
  • 5. re: js 组合框
  • <option value="csdn">csdn</option>
  • --saletopbags

阅读排行榜

  • 1. hand in hand(380)
  • 2. 桃花记(255)
  • 3. 月夜随想(235)
  • 4. 冬至随想(228)

评论排行榜

  • 1. hand in hand(2)
  • 2. 桃花记(0)
  • 3. 月夜随想(0)
  • 4. 冬至随想(0)

Powered by: 博客园
模板提供:沪江博客
BlogJava | 首页 | 发新随笔 | 发新文章 | 联系 | 聚合 | 管理

学用ORACLE AWR和ASH特性 (5)生成不同时间内的对比统计报表 转自三思http://www.5ienet.com/note/html/ash_awr/oracle-create-awr-different-report.shtml

(5)生成不同时间内的对比统计报表
[君三思] 2009-11-4

2.5  生成不同时间段时的统计对比报表

  在没有awr之前,如果希望对不同时间段时,数据库的整体影响进行对比,只能依靠DBA手工查询相关视图,并通过时间条件来获取差异(还有些统计已经无法对比),而在AWR中,直接就提供了,对不同时间段时,数据库的性能统计做差异对比的功能。

  执行脚本如下:

    SQL>  @$ORACLE_HOME/rdbms/admin/awrddrpt.sql

    Current Instance

    ~~~~~~~~~~~~~~~~

       DB Id       DB Id    DB Name      Inst Num Inst Num Instance

    ----------- ----------- ------------ -------- -------- ------------

     3812548755  3812548755 TEST08              1        1 test08

    Specify the Report Type

    ~~~~~~~~~~~~~~~~~~~~~~~

    Would you like an HTML report, or a plain text report?

    Enter ¨html¨ for an HTML report, or ¨text¨ for plain text

    Defaults to ¨html¨

    Enter value for report_type: html

  生成的报表格式,没啥说的,就默认的html格式吧。

    Type Specified:  html

    Instances in this Workload Repository schema

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

       DB Id     Inst Num DB Name      Instance     Host

    ------------ -------- ------------ ------------ ------------

    * 3812548755        1 TEST08       test08       yans1

    Database Id and Instance Number for the First Pair of Snapshots

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Using 3812548755 for Database Id for the first pair of snapshots

    Using          1 for Instance Number for the first pair of snapshots

  注意,下面紧接着,是选择第一份报表的相关参数,包括快照的区间,以及开始和结束的快照ID:

    Specify the number of days of snapshots to choose from

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Entering the number of days (n) will result in the most recent

    (n) days of snapshots being listed.  Pressing <return> without

    specifying a number lists all completed snapshots.

    Enter value for num_days:  2

    Listing the last 2 days of Completed Snapshots

                                                            Snap

    Instance     DB Name        Snap Id    Snap Started    Level

    ------------ ------------ --------- ------------------ -----

    test08       TEST08            7450 25 10 月 2009 00:00     1

                                   7451 25 10 月 2009 01:00     1

                                   7452 25 10 月 2009 02:00     1

                                   7453 25 10 月 2009 03:00     1

                                   7454 25 10 月 2009 04:00     1

                                   7455 25 10 月 2009 05:00     1

                                   7456 25 10 月 2009 06:00     1

                                   7457 25 10 月 2009 07:00     1

                                   7458 25 10 月 2009 08:00     1

                                   7459 25 10 月 2009 09:00     1

                                   7460 25 10 月 2009 10:00     1

                                   7461 25 10 月 2009 11:00     1

                                   7462 25 10 月 2009 12:00     1

                                   7463 25 10 月 2009 13:00     1

                                   7464 25 10 月 2009 14:00     1

                                   7465 25 10 月 2009 15:00     1

                                   7466 25 10 月 2009 16:00     1

                                   7467 25 10 月 2009 17:00     1

                                   7468 25 10 月 2009 18:00     1

                                   7469 25 10 月 2009 19:00     1

                                   7470 25 10 月 2009 20:00     1

                                   7471 25 10 月 2009 21:00     1

                                   7472 25 10 月 2009 22:00     1

                                   7473 25 10 月 2009 23:00     1

                                   7474 26 10 月 2009 00:00     1

                                   7475 26 10 月 2009 01:00     1

                                   7476 26 10 月 2009 02:00     1

                                   7477 26 10 月 2009 03:00     1

                                   7478 26 10 月 2009 04:00     1

                                   7479 26 10 月 2009 05:00     1

                                   7480 26 10 月 2009 06:00     1

                                   7481 26 10 月 2009 07:00     1

                                   7482 26 10 月 2009 08:00     1

                                   7483 26 10 月 2009 09:00     1

                                   7484 26 10 月 2009 10:00     1

                                   7485 26 10 月 2009 11:00     1

                                   7486 26 10 月 2009 12:00     1

                                   7487 26 10 月 2009 13:00     1

                                   7488 26 10 月 2009 14:00     1

                                   7489 26 10 月 2009 15:00     1

    Specify the First Pair of Begin and End Snapshot Ids

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Enter value for begin_snap:  7459

    First Begin Snapshot Id specified: 7459

    Enter value for end_snap:  7462

    First End   Snapshot Id specified: 7462

  然后,是选择要对比的报表相关参数,包括快照的区间,以及开始和结束的快照ID:

    Instances in this Workload Repository schema

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

       DB Id     Inst Num DB Name      Instance     Host

    ------------ -------- ------------ ------------ ------------

    * 3812548755        1 TEST08       test08       yans1

    Database Id and Instance Number for the Second Pair of Snapshots

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Using 3812548755 for Database Id for the second pair of snapshots

    Using          1 for Instance Number for the second pair of snapshots

    Specify the number of days of snapshots to choose from

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Entering the number of days (n) will result in the most recent

    (n) days of snapshots being listed.  Pressing <return> without

    specifying a number lists all completed snapshots.

    Enter value for num_days2:  2

    Listing the last 2 days of Completed Snapshots

                                                            Snap

    Instance     DB Name        Snap Id    Snap Started    Level

    ------------ ------------ --------- ------------------ -----

    test08       TEST08            7450 25 10 月 2009 00:00     1

                                   7451 25 10 月 2009 01:00     1

                                   7452 25 10 月 2009 02:00     1

                                   7453 25 10 月 2009 03:00     1

                                   7454 25 10 月 2009 04:00     1

                                   7455 25 10 月 2009 05:00     1

                                   7456 25 10 月 2009 06:00     1

                                   7457 25 10 月 2009 07:00     1

                                   7458 25 10 月 2009 08:00     1

                                   7459 25 10 月 2009 09:00     1

                                   7460 25 10 月 2009 10:00     1

                                   7461 25 10 月 2009 11:00     1

                                   7462 25 10 月 2009 12:00     1

                                   7463 25 10 月 2009 13:00     1

                                   7464 25 10 月 2009 14:00     1

                                   7465 25 10 月 2009 15:00     1

                                   7466 25 10 月 2009 16:00     1

                                   7467 25 10 月 2009 17:00     1

                                   7468 25 10 月 2009 18:00     1

                                   7469 25 10 月 2009 19:00     1

                                   7470 25 10 月 2009 20:00     1

                                   7471 25 10 月 2009 21:00     1

                                   7472 25 10 月 2009 22:00     1

                                   7473 25 10 月 2009 23:00     1

                                   7474 26 10 月 2009 00:00     1

                                   7475 26 10 月 2009 01:00     1

                                   7476 26 10 月 2009 02:00     1

                                   7477 26 10 月 2009 03:00     1

                                   7478 26 10 月 2009 04:00     1

                                   7479 26 10 月 2009 05:00     1

                                   7480 26 10 月 2009 06:00     1

                                   7481 26 10 月 2009 07:00     1

                                   7482 26 10 月 2009 08:00     1

                                   7483 26 10 月 2009 09:00     1

                                   7484 26 10 月 2009 10:00     1

                                   7485 26 10 月 2009 11:00     1

                                   7486 26 10 月 2009 12:00     1

                                   7487 26 10 月 2009 13:00     1

                                   7488 26 10 月 2009 14:00     1

                                   7489 26 10 月 2009 15:00     1

    Specify the Second Pair of Begin and End Snapshot Ids

    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

    Enter value for begin_snap2:  7483

    Second Begin Snapshot Id specified: 7483

    Enter value for end_snap2:  7486

    Second End   Snapshot Id specified: 7486

  最后,为要生成的报表命令:

    Specify the Report Name

    ~~~~~~~~~~~~~~~~~~~~~~~

    The default report file name is awrdiff_1_7459_1_7483.html  To use this name,

    press <return> to continue, otherwise enter an alternative.

    Enter value for report_name: awr_diff_1_7459_1_7483.html

    Using the report name awr_diff_1_7459_1_7483.html

    <HTML><HEAD><TITLE>Workload Repository Compare Period Report</TITLE>

    ...............

    ...............

  报表生成以后,在显示时将以并列的形式,直观的显示出两个不同时间段里,数据库各项参数的差异,摘要如图:

  

2.6  生成指定SQL语句的统计报表

  前例的对比是在单实例环境下进行的,如果希望对多实例的数据库做对比,那就要使用$ORACLE_HOME/rdbms/admin/awrddrpi.sql脚本了。该脚本的操作基本与前例相同,这里不再演示,感兴趣的朋友不妨自行测试。

发表于 2009-11-23 09:46 javaex 阅读(417) 评论(0)  编辑  收藏 所属分类: ORACLE
 
新用户注册  刷新评论列表  

只有注册用户登录后才能发表评论。


网站导航:
博客园   IT新闻   Chat2DB   C++博客   博问   管理
相关文章:
  • Oracle 10g Scheduler 特性 转自 http://blog.csdn.net/tianlesoftware/archive/2009/10/22/4715218.aspx
  • 全面学习ORACLE Scheduler特性 (12)使用Window和Window Group 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-using-window.shtml
  • 全面学习ORACLE Scheduler特性 (11)使用Job Classes 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-using-job-classes.shtml
  • 全面学习ORACLE Scheduler特性 (10)使用Chains之管理CHAIN 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-alter-chains.shtml
  • 全面学习ORACLE Scheduler特性 (9)使用Chains之创建CHAIN 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-create-chains.shtml
  • 全面学习ORACLE Scheduler特性 (8)使用Events之Aapplication抛出的Events 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-using-application-events.shtml
  • 全面学习ORACLE Scheduler特性 (7)使用Events之Scheduler抛出的Events 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-using-scheduler-events.shtml
  • 全面学习ORACLE Scheduler特性 (6)设置Repeat Interval参数 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-repeat_interval.shtml
  • 全面学习ORACLE Scheduler特性 (5)Schedules调度Programs执行的Jobs 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-schedule-job-execute.shtml
  • 全面学习ORACLE Scheduler特性 (4)使用和管理Schedules 转自三思 http://www.5ienet.com/note/html/scheduler/oracle-scheduler-create-schedule.shtml